    Cave Filling LP versus HP tanks

    Take the rated volume of the tank at service pressure, divide by service pressure, and multiply by desired pressure. I prefer to calculate for every tank a 'tank factor' that represents how many cubic feet every 100 PSI yield. That makes gas planning real easy. Tank Factor = Rated Volume /...

    Cave Filling LP versus HP tanks

    300 bar is ~4350 PSI. That's a lot, even in cave country. EU test pressure would be 6525 PSI (50% over service pressure) on these tanks whereas our 3AA 2400 PSI tanks get tested to 4000 PSI (5/3 of service pressure). Assuming that both tanks were designed so that their test pressure is less...

    Woefully inadequate HP80'S

    +1 If you have 3AA tanks with a "+" next to the born date, insist on keeping that rating. It requires additional testing equipment at the hydro facility to measure the minimum wall thickness. If they give you excuses that the "+" rating needs to have been issued at every hydro (which is BS) or...
